Output 8fc3f0c14f6f1c1199a25efce4476474c1efb0fff0aff502b0cf53ce33fdae33:62

value
700584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5abe2024ec532362381fc0808cef5ea9408dde OP_EQUAL
address
34BesdnJgFEAiXsNCwc6WHXpDtFUYQ6tMo
transaction
8fc3f0c14f6f1c1199a25efce4476474c1efb0fff0aff502b0cf53ce33fdae33
confirmations
243026
spent
true